Best friends Maxx and Darsey are fascinated by a planet far, far away on the other side of the galaxy, and when the chance arises to stow away on an exploratory mission, they cannot resist a trip to...planet Earth! Three-dimensional layered pages enable youngsters to explore every aspect of this tale of intergalactic intrigue. Peek through the pop-up windows, open the door to the top-secret facility, and discover what happens during the little aliens' fantastic voyage. It offers out-of-this-world reading for 3- to 7-year-olds. Maxx and Darsey live on planet X-Roxx in a solar system on the edge of the Milky Way. At school, the young aliens are enjoying learning about other planets. The one they like best is called Earth. They have intergalactic 'pen pals' there, called Ben and Joe. Maxx and Darsey would dearly love to meet their friends - and when they hear that Darsey's uncle is leading a research mission to Earth, they decide to tag along. Peer into the dark depths of the shuttle bay as they sneak aboard! Gaze through the ship's viewport into the vastness of space! However, when secret agents notice the little alien visitors on Earth, Ben and Joe must rush to their rescue. You can follow the brave youngsters down the long corridors of the Alien Holding Hub (or AHH for short)...Young readers will be gripped by this thrilling story, and the detailed pop-up illustrations will take them right into the heart of the adventure.
Stopped on the way to attacking his high school with an assault rifle, Tim Hutchinson knew that life was the battlefield, and fate his merciless enemy. Painful Secrets is the shocking true story of one young man's battle against bullies, drugs, firearms, gangs, prostitution, the KKK and a downward spiral that was sure to plummet him into an early grave. Homeless, suicidal, and out of options, he dreamed of rebuilding the tangled wreckage that barely resembled a life. Pushed into the darkest corners of life - across the street from hell, he became homeless, suicidal, and was out of options. Yet he dared to dream of rebuilding the tangled wreckage that barely resembled a life. This memoir details how the mentoring of a holocaust survivor turned his life around so dramatically, that some hardened criminals were shocked into reality and now live by Hutchinson's example. Tim is now a motivational speaker who visits K-12 schools and clearly shows students, teachers and parents how to stop the violence, bullying, and drug abuse that is so prevalent in almost every community. Using his life as an example, as described in Painful Secrets, Tim has already stopped four school shootings and prevented over fifty teen suicides. He has also been a consultant on youth issues with the U.S. Department of Justice and MTV. He is additionally proud that his daughter is the youngest person in America to be awarded the 'Medal of Valor'. Painful Secrets clearly shows how any teen can escape from the tangled web of hate and violence, and go on to lead a successful, happy life. It also serves as a deterrent for those who have not yet taken the wrong fork in life.
Lonely Planet Kids' How Animals Build is a beautifully illustrated lift-the-flap hardback that explores the incredible world of animal architects. Children can open flaps and unfold spreads to discover amazing animal homes up high, underground, on land, and under the sea. From spider webs and rabbit warrens, to bird nests and ant colonies, and even coral reefs and beaver lodges, we reveal the secrets to these extraordinary structures and how they're built. Do bees need cement mixers to build hives? Do beavers use cranes to construct dams? No, of course not! Like many animals, they're building geniuses who don't need building site tools to create incredible work. Welcome to nature's very own, super-clever world of construction. Created in consultation with Michael Leach, wildlife expert, speaker, photographer, filmographer, and author of over 20 books on subjects ranging from big cats and owls to great apes and bears.
